About this title
Synopsis
The barn is a hundred and ten years old and held hay until 1994. There is a mat in it now, salvaged from a school that closed, and a wood stove that does not reach the far corner, and a single bulb. Elias Deschamps is sixteen and in there most nights until his hands stop closing. In this state the champions come from three schools, all of them four hours south, all of them with wrestling rooms and thirty partners and a bus. One of those schools has now called twice. And since November, nine kids under thirteen have started walking out to the barn after supper, because the light is on and Elias is in there.
Who this is about
Elias Deschamps is sixteen and wrestles at one hundred and thirty-eight pounds. He trains in a hay barn his uncle converted, on the edge of the reservation, in the dark, mostly alone.
What goes wrong
A program in Billings offers him a place, a bed, and a wrestling room full of partners his own size. Nine younger kids have started showing up at the barn because he is in it.
What's at stake
Nobody from this county has ever placed at state. Going gets him there. Staying means wrestling alone against boys who have thirty partners, and it means the nine keep having somewhere to go.
Why it keeps going
Each episode is one more week of the season, one more younger kid in the barn, and one more phone call from Billings that Elias has not returned. The land goes up for sale in spring.
Takeaway
A room is only a room until somebody is in it who makes other people want to come.
